Barbecue Meatballs
This recipe is perfect as a side dish or an appetizer. Make it for the holidays, and it may soon become a family tradition. It has a buffetstyle feel that your guests and family will love!

Instructies
Preheat the oven to 350° F.
Mix the first 8 ingredients in a large mixing bowl.
Crumble the ground beef over the mixture and mix well.
Shape the meat mixture into 1-inch balls.
Place the meatballs on a lightly oiled rack in a thin baking pan.
Bake the meatballs (uncovered) for 18 to 20 minutes, or until the meat is no longer pink.
Drain, but keep the meatballs on the rack.
Meanwhile, combine all of the sauce ingredients in a saucepan.
Boil the mixture.
Reduce the heat and simmer for about two minutes.
Be sure to stir frequently.
Pour the sauce over the meatballs.
Bake for an additional 10 to 12 minutes.
